Question
I was driving out of my condo association office's parking lot this afternoon when one of the guys who worked there parked me in so he could talk to me (he's a creep). He came over to tell me that if I didn't have a state inspection sticker in my front window (I just moved and haven't gotten it done yet), he could have my car towed just like if I didn't have a proper parking sticker (which I do).

Can a private company (or private individual, for that matter) have a private towing company tow my car for a state vehicle maintenance infraction? That doesn't seem at all kosher to me.

Answer
Check over your rental contract as to the terms and conditions on parking. I think you may find something stating the vehicle must be currently licensed, registered and in proper or acceptable condition. Most acceptable condition also falls under current inspection. It is not just your complex but most complexes I know of have the same regulations. IMO, just get it done immediately because they are watching and will save you a lot time and grief (police and parking) in the long run.
